Dynamo برای کاربران Grasshopper

Dynamo برای کاربران Grasshopper
معرفی
کاربران Grasshopper که قصد یادگیری Dynamo را دارند، برای اینکه بدانند دستورات و گره های معادل ان در داینامو چه می باشد، لیست زیر به آنها بسیار کمک می کند. شما به عنوان یک کاربر Grasshopper با این بررسی ها می توانید از توانایی های خود در Grasshopper، برای ارتقاء داینامو استفاده کنید.
نکات
شاید دشوارترین مفهوم برای استفاده کاربران Grasshopper از داینامو در درک اینکه چگونه دایناموNested lists (لیست های تو در تو) را مدیریت می کند.. در Grasshopper شما با Data Trees و نیاز به آنها برای مطابقت آشنا هستید. کامپوننت هایی مانند Transplant، Flatten، Simplify و Mapper تبدیل می شوند. تصویر زیر نشان می دهد چگونه یک آرایه ۲ بعدی ساده از حلقه ها ایجاد کنید. هنگامی که یک ردیف ایجاد می شود، یک سری از اعداد به یکدیگر متصل می شوند و مسیرهای داده های متعدد را ایجاد می کنند.
با این حال، در Dynamo، ما می توانیم به سادگی از Lacing در هنگام ایجاد نقاط استفاده. کنیم با تنظیم زنجیره ای به ” Cross Product’ ” ما به صورت خودکار آرایه ای ۲ بعدی از نقاط را دریافت می کنیم. در حالی که برخی از گره ها در لیست کار می کنند، و برخی نمی کنند. به عنوان مثال، دایره ها تقریبا همانند عمل می کند، اصلاحات Data Tree مورد نیاز نیست. با این حال، اگر ما می خواهیم طول هر لیست توزیع شده را محاسبه کنیم، باید از گره ‘List.Map’ استفاده کنیم. این گره تابع را به Data Tree دیگر تکرار می کند. توجه داشته باشید که هیچ ورودی به گره List.Count متصل نیست. فهرست لیست ها به طور مستقیم به گره List.Map تغذیه می شود. این اساسا متفاوت است که چگونه Grasshopper پردازش داده ها را انجام می دهد و می تواند به طور باور نکردنی برای کاربران Grasshopper گیج کننده باشد. اما نترس، آموزش های ویدئویی زیادی در مورد این موضوع وجود دارد.
- از نسخه ۰٫۸، داینامو اساسا بدون واحد است. این امر به داینامو اجازه می دهد که یک محیط برنامه نویسی تصویری انتزاعی باقی بماند. گره های دایناموکه با ابعاد Revit ارتباط دارند، واحدهای پروژه Revit را ارزیابی خواهند کرد.
داینامودر حالت sandbox، nodes Revit را ندارد.
عمومی ها :
ریاضیات :
مجموعه ها:
بردارها:
منحنی ها:
پوسته ها:
برخوردها:
جابجا کننده ها:
نکته : برای یادگیری برنامه Dynamo به صورت تخصصی و کاربردی می توانید از آموزش های داینامو تیم IRAN-BIM موجود در فروشگاه سایت استفاده کنید.
دیدگاهتان را بنویسید
برای نوشتن دیدگاه باید وارد بشوید.